Output 8deb366dd835bc31fbc77c909252e046b0c48aba3943c1e0e933a4ee98eebe17:45

value
13106451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d04295fb15b77bcaad4b80dcbd2909eabb204dee OP_EQUAL
address
MStLYoDt7CTqxRSSBJtYwLsWEBgpa19jm2
transaction
8deb366dd835bc31fbc77c909252e046b0c48aba3943c1e0e933a4ee98eebe17
spent
true